How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Warrenville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Warrenville Studio Apartments | $2,327 | $1,477 | $5,159 |
Warrenville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,417 | $1,245 | $5,680 |
Warrenville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,858 | $1,489 | $4,592 |
Warrenville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,741 | $2,800 | $6,338 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Warrenville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Warrenville with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Warrenville is at Arden Luxury Apartments and Townhomes listed at $2,922.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Warrenville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Warrenville is $3,741.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Warrenville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Warrenville is a 1,747 square feet unit starting from $3,595 at Arden Luxury Apartments and Townhomes.
What is the average size for Warrenville 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Warrenville is currently 1,722 sq ft.
